What is exponential growth ?
Exponential growth is a mathematical concept that describes a process in which the quantity or size of something increases at a constant rate proportional to its current value. In other words, exponential growth occurs when a quantity grows at an increasing rate over time, so that the amount of growth is itself growing exponentially.
For example, if a population of bacteria doubles every hour, then the rate of growth is proportional to the current population size, and the population will grow exponentially over time. Exponential growth can also occur in financial investments, where the interest earned on an investment is reinvested and earns additional interest, leading to exponential growth in the value of the investment.
According to the question:
a. We can use the formula for exponential growth to write an exponential function that represents the population after t years:
\(y = ab^t\)
where y is the population after t years, a is the initial population, b is the growth factor, and t is the time in years.
Since the population y increases by 5% each year, the growth factor b is 1 + r, where r is the growth rate expressed as a decimal. In this case, r = 5% = 0.05, so b = 1 + 0.05 = 1.05.
The initial population a is 435,000, so we have:
\(y = 435,000(1.05)^t\)
b. To find the population after 11 years, we substitute t = 11 into the exponential function we found in part a:
\(y = 435,000(1.05)^{11}\)
Using a calculator, we get:
y ≈ 741,536.72
Rounding to the nearest thousand, the population after 11 years will be 742,000.

Find the minimum value of
C = x+y
subject to the following constraints:
2x + y 2 20
2x + 3y2 36
x20
(y20
C = [?]
Enter
What does C equal?? PLEASE HELP WILL GIVE LOTS OF POINTS!!!
Answer:
C = 14
Step-by-step explanation:
\(C = x+y\)
\(2x + y \geq 20\)
\(2x + 3y\geq 36\)
\(x\geq 0\)
\(y\geq 0\)
If we graph the inequalities, the solution set of the constraints is the shaded area (see attached diagram).
The vertices of the shaded area are (0, 20), (6, 8) and (18, 0)
To determine the minimum value of C, substitute the values of x and y of each vertex into C = x + y:
at (0, 20): C = 0 + 20 = 20
at (6, 8): C = 6 + 8 = 14
at (18, 0): C = 18 + 0 = 18
Therefore, the minimum value is at (6, 8) ⇒ C = 14

A shopkeep offers a discount of 20% on all the articles at his shop and still makes a profit of 12%. What is the CP of an article whose MP is Rs280?
CORRECT answer will be mark as brainliest.
Help me!
Given info:-
A shop keeper offers a discount of 20% on all the articles at his shop and all makes a profit of 12%.
What is the CP of an article whose MP is Rs. 280 ?
Explanation:-
Given that
The Marked Price of an article (M) = Rs. 280
Discount on it = 20%
Discount (D) = MD/100
⇛ Discount = (280×20)/100
⇛ Discount = 28×2
⇛ Discount =56
Selling Price = Marked Price - Discount
⇛ Selling Price = 280-56
⇛ Selling Price = Rs. 224
Selling Price of the article = 224
Profit on it = 12%
We know that
Cost Price = (100×SP)/(100+g)
⇛ CP = (100×224)/(100+12)
⇛ CP = 22400/112
⇛ CP = 200
Therefore, The CP = Rs. 200
The Cost Price of the article = Rs. 200.
Formula:-
Discount (D) = MD/100M = Marked Price
Selling Price = Marked Price - Discount Cost Price = (100×SP)/(100+g)SP = Selling Price
g = gain or profit

What are the x-intercept and the y-intercept of the graph of 9x − 7y = −63?A.x-intercept: 7; y-intercept: −9B.x-intercept: −7; y-intercept: 9C.x-intercept: 9; y-intercept: −7D.x-intercept: −9; y-intercept: 7
Equation of a line:
9x - 7y = -63
To find the x-intercept we have to substitute y = 0 into the equation, as follows:
9x - 7*0 = -63
9x = -63
Dividing by 9 at both sides of the equation:
9x/9 = -63/9
x = -7
To find the y-intercept we have to substitute x = 0 into the equation, as follows:
9*0 - 7y = -63
-7y = -63
Dividing by -7 at both sides of the equation:
-7y/(-7) = -63/(-7)
y = 9
Answer
x-intercept: −7; y-intercept: 9
